计算机基础知识(深入了解计算机基础知识)
59
2024-04-30
具有着丰富的基础知识、C语言作为一门广泛应用于软件开发领域的编程语言。掌握C语言的基础知识对于学习和理解更高级的编程概念至关重要。流程控制等,包括数据类型、帮助读者建立起扎实的编程基础,本文将深入探究C语言的基础知识,变量,运算符。
1.数据类型:不同数据类型在内存中占用的空间和表示范围有所不同,字符型和指针型等,C语言中的数据类型是编程过程中最基本的概念,包括整型、浮点型。
2.变量与常量:变量用于存储和表示数据、而常量则是固定不变的数值或字符,在C语言中。并解释常量的概念及其应用、介绍如何声明变量、赋值和修改变量的值。
3.运算符:逻辑运算符等,包括算术运算符,关系运算符,C语言提供了多种运算符用于对变量和常量进行各种运算操作。详细介绍各类运算符及其使用方法。
4.表达式与语句:用于计算和生成值、表达式由运算符和操作数组成,在C语言中。而语句则是对程序执行过程中的具体指令和控制流程的描述。
5.控制流:循环语句和跳转语句,用于根据不同条件执行不同的程序代码块,C语言提供了多种流程控制语句,包括条件语句。
6.数组与字符串:字符串则是由字符组成的字符数组、数组是一种存储相同类型数据的。访问方法以及常见操作,介绍数组和字符串的声明方式。
7.函数:用于封装一段特定功能的代码、函数是C语言程序中的独立模块。调用和参数传递方式,并介绍函数的作用域和生命周期,探讨函数的定义。
8.结构体与联合体:而联合体则是共享内存空间的不同数据类型,可以将不同类型的数据组合在一起,结构体是一种自定义的数据类型。详细介绍结构体和联合体的定义与使用。
9.指针:用于存储和操作内存地址,指针是C语言中重要的概念。以及指针与数组、讨论指针的声明,初始化和使用,字符串的关系。
10.文件操作:用于读写外部文件,C语言提供了文件操作函数。关闭,探究文件的打开,读写操作,以及文件指针的概念和使用方法。
11.预处理指令:包括宏定义、预处理指令是在编译之前对代码进行处理的指令,条件编译等。介绍预处理指令的语法和常见应用。
12.动态内存管理:用于灵活地分配和释放内存空间,动态内存管理是C语言中重要的概念。讨论动态内存分配函数malloc和释放函数free的使用方法。
13.输入与输出:用于从键盘获取输入或向屏幕输出结果、C语言提供了多种输入输出函数。详细介绍输入输出函数的使用和常见错误处理。
14.多文件程序:将程序代码分为多个文件有助于代码管理和模块化、在大型项目中。探讨多文件程序的组织方式和编译链接过程。
15.常见问题及解决方法:逻辑错误等,包括语法错误,C语言学习过程中常见的问题和解决方法,并给出相应的调试技巧和建议。
为学习和理解更高级的编程概念打下坚实的基础,读者可以建立起扎实的编程基础、通过对C语言基础知识的深入探究。读者可以更好地应用C语言进行软件开发和程序设计、掌握了C语言的基础知识。对于学习其他编程语言也具有重要的借鉴意义、同时。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。